在大数据时代,分布式计算与云存储技术已经成为推动信息社会发展的关键力量。随着数据量的爆炸式增长,传统的本地计算和存储方式已无法满足需求,因此,分布式计算与云存储技术应运而生,它们通过将数据分散存储到多个服务器上,利用云计算的强大计算能力,实现了对海量数据的高效处理和分析。
分布式计算技术的核心在于将大规模数据集分解为更小、更易于管理的部分,然后通过网络将这些部分分配给多个计算节点进行处理。这种技术可以显著提高数据处理速度,减少延迟,并降低单点故障的风险。分布式计算技术主要包括MapReduce、Spark等框架,它们通过并行处理和分布式存储,使得大数据分析变得更加高效和准确。
云存储技术则是通过将数据存储在远程服务器上,为用户提供随时随地访问数据的能力。与传统的本地存储相比,云存储具有更高的可扩展性和灵活性,用户可以根据需要随时调整存储空间,而无需担心硬件升级或维护问题。此外,云存储还提供了数据备份、恢复等功能,确保数据的安全性和可靠性。
在大数据时代,分布式计算与云存储技术的革新主要体现在以下几个方面:
1. 数据处理能力的提升:通过分布式计算技术,我们可以在多个计算节点上同时处理大量数据,大大提升了数据处理的速度和效率。例如,在金融领域,分布式计算技术可以帮助银行实时监控交易数据,及时发现异常交易行为,从而防范金融风险。
2. 数据分析的深度挖掘:云存储技术使得用户可以随时随地访问大量的数据,通过大数据分析和机器学习算法,我们可以从中发现隐藏在数据背后的规律和趋势,为企业决策提供有力支持。例如,在医疗领域,通过对患者历史病历的分析,我们可以预测疾病的发展趋势,为医生制定治疗方案提供参考。
3. 数据安全与隐私保护:分布式计算技术可以通过加密和权限控制等方式,确保数据在传输和存储过程中的安全。同时,云存储技术还可以为用户提供数据备份和恢复功能,防止数据丢失或泄露。例如,在电商领域,通过分布式计算技术,我们可以实现对用户购物行为的实时监控,同时利用云存储技术保护用户个人信息不被泄露。
4. 人工智能与机器学习的应用:分布式计算技术和云存储技术的结合,为人工智能和机器学习的发展提供了强大的计算资源。通过在云端部署大量的计算任务,我们可以训练出更加精准的模型,提高人工智能系统的性能。例如,在自动驾驶领域,通过分布式计算技术,我们可以实时收集和处理来自车辆、传感器等多种来源的数据,为自动驾驶提供准确的决策支持。
总之,在大数据时代,分布式计算与云存储技术已经成为推动社会进步的重要力量。它们不仅提高了数据处理的效率和准确性,还为数据分析、数据安全和隐私保护等方面提供了有力支持。未来,随着技术的不断发展和完善,我们有理由相信,分布式计算与云存储技术将在更多领域发挥更大的作用,为人类社会带来更多的便利和价值。